Iter8: Metrics-Driven Release Optimizer
Iter8 is a metrics-driven release optimizer built for DevSecOps, MLOps, SRE and data science teams. Iter8 makes it easy to ensure that new versions of apps and ML models perform well, are secure, and maximize business value.
π Features at a glance
- Load test, benchmark and validate HTTP services with SLOs
- Load test, benchmark and validate gRPC services with SLOs
- Use in GitHub Action workflows

Overview ΒΆ
Package main is the entry point for the Iter8 CLI. Iter8: Kubernetes release optimizer built for DevOps, MLOps, SRE, and data science teams. Iter8 experiments make it simple to collect performance and business metrics for apps and ML models, assess, compare and validate one or more app/ML model versions, promote the winning version, and maximize business value in each release.
